Bill Maynard and I saw an adult male a Baltimore Oriole this morning at Fountain Creek Regional Park, El Paso County. The bird was along warbler alley south of Fountain Creek Nature Center. This species is pretty rare this far west. Photographs were taken. -- Brandon K. Percival Pueblo West,

The male Bay Breasted Warbler continues at Crow Valley Campground at noon today. I found it in the northwest corner of the campground in the trees above the creek behind and just to the west of the group picnic structure. It was enjoyed by several other birders looking for it. Joe Mammoser
